The Role of Cell Cycle Control in Haemopoietic Stem Cell Fate Decisions. [ 2009 - 2013 ]

Also known as: Understanding How Cell Division Affects Blood Stem Cells.

Researchers: A/Pr Carl Walkley (Principal investigator)

Brief description My research has focused on understanding how the process of cell division can result in different outcomes for adult blood stem cells. I am interested in determining the role of bone and blood vessels in the regulation of blood stem cells and in the development of blood diseases (myeloprolifertive disease). I will also determine the effects of changing the cell cycle with drugs to improve transplantation of blood stem cells.

Funding Amount $AUD 390,974.78

Funding Scheme Career Development Fellowships

Notes RD Wright Biomedical CDF
